Birk Sign with Ravens

Longtime Minnesota Vikings center, Matt Birk signed a three-year deal with the Baltimore Ravens. The deal is worth $12 mil with half guaranteed.

Birk is a six-time Pro Bowler and a St. Paul native. It was thought that Birk, 32, would go on the circuit but end up back with the Vikes. I guess not.
